服务监控平台如何进行故障诊断?

在当今数字化时代,服务监控平台已经成为企业确保业务稳定运行的重要工具。然而,当服务监控平台出现故障时,如何快速诊断并解决问题,成为摆在运维人员面前的一大挑战。本文将深入探讨服务监控平台如何进行故障诊断,帮助读者掌握故障诊断的技巧和方法。

一、了解服务监控平台

首先,我们需要了解服务监控平台的基本功能和组成部分。服务监控平台主要包括以下几个方面:

  1. 数据采集:通过各类传感器、API接口、日志文件等方式,实时采集系统、应用、网络等各方面的数据。

  2. 数据处理:对采集到的数据进行清洗、转换、存储等操作,为后续分析提供数据基础。

  3. 数据分析:运用算法、模型等手段,对数据进行分析,发现潜在问题和异常。

  4. 告警与通知:当检测到异常时,平台会及时发出告警信息,通知相关人员处理。

  5. 故障处理:提供故障处理流程和工具,帮助运维人员快速定位和解决问题。

二、故障诊断方法

  1. 日志分析

加粗日志分析是故障诊断的重要手段之一。通过分析系统日志、应用日志、网络日志等,可以了解故障发生前后的情况,从而定位故障原因。

斜体以下是一些常见的日志分析方法:

  • 时间序列分析:观察故障发生前后的日志记录,分析故障发生的时间规律。
  • 异常值分析:找出异常的日志记录,分析其与故障的关系。
  • 关联分析:分析不同日志之间的关联性,找出故障的根源。

  1. 性能监控

性能监控是故障诊断的另一个重要手段。通过实时监控系统、应用、网络等各方面的性能指标,可以及时发现异常并定位故障。

加粗以下是一些常见的性能监控方法:

  • 指标分析:分析关键性能指标(KPI)的变化趋势,找出异常情况。
  • 趋势分析:分析性能指标的变化趋势,预测故障发生。
  • 对比分析:对比不同时间段、不同系统、不同应用的性能指标,找出异常。

  1. 故障树分析

故障树分析是一种系统性的故障诊断方法。通过将故障分解为多个原因,逐步排查,最终找到故障的根本原因。

加粗以下是一些故障树分析步骤:

  1. 确定故障现象:明确故障的具体表现。

  2. 分解故障原因:将故障分解为多个可能的原因。

  3. 建立故障树:将故障原因与故障现象之间的关系用树状图表示。

  4. 排查故障原因:根据故障树,逐步排查故障原因。

  5. 案例分析

以下是一个服务监控平台故障诊断的案例分析:

某企业服务监控平台突然无法正常工作,导致运维人员无法及时发现和处理故障。经过调查,发现是由于数据库存储空间不足导致的。以下是故障诊断过程:

  1. 日志分析:通过分析数据库日志,发现存储空间不足的告警信息。
  2. 性能监控:通过监控数据库性能指标,发现存储空间占用率持续上升。
  3. 故障树分析:将故障分解为“存储空间不足”这一原因。
  4. 解决问题:通过扩容数据库存储空间,解决故障。

三、总结

服务监控平台的故障诊断是一个复杂的过程,需要结合多种方法和技巧。通过了解服务监控平台的基本功能、掌握故障诊断方法,并参考实际案例分析,运维人员可以更好地应对故障,确保业务稳定运行。

猜你喜欢:Prometheus